This fund aims to capture the total U.S. stock market via the Fidelity U.S. Total Investable Market Index, which is likely comparable to the Russell 3000 Index. Essentially, FNILX + FZIPX = FZROX. It's comparable to something like VTI from Vanguard. This is huge. Think about it this way. Fidelity’s new funds are “free” whereas Vanguard’s 0.04% expense ratio will cost you $4 in fees for every $10,000 in your portfolio. BUT, Vanguard’s increased tax efficiency means you’ll lose $51 less in taxes each year.

Learn more about mutual funds at fidelity.com. gaocx Fidelity index mutual funds typically pay out only once or twice a year. All of the Zero line I believe just once. 7. BoglesFollies. • 1 yr. ago. To add to this, FXAIX distributes dividends quarterly; FSKAX semi annually (April, December); the Zero funds distribute dividends once annually (December) 3. r/Bogleheads.
